ORDER
This writ petition is filed for the following relief: "To direct the respondents to dispose of the representation of the petitioner dated 21.02.2026 in the light of the proceedings of the first respondent to the second respondent vide Na.Ka.No. Service.3(2) / 01-19 /26/ 2023 dated 22.09.2025."
2. The petitioner was appointed as an Office Assistant in the Revenue Department on 23.12.1982. On 20.02.1997, he became Record Clerk and subsequently he was promoted to the post of Junior Assistant on 09.10.1999. Thereafter, the petitioner was promoted as Assistant and posted as Revenue Inspector on 19.10.2002.
3. The case of the petitioner is that he became eligible for promotion to the post of Deputy Tahsildar in the panel drawn for the year 2011. However, his name was not included in the promotion panel. Therefore, the petitioner approached this Court and this Court by order dated 17.04.2012 set aside the order of the 2nd respondent dated 06.01.2012 and directed the respondents to consider the name of the petitioner for inclusion in the panel for promotion to the post of Deputy Tahsildar.
4. The case of the petitioner is that after protracted correspondence, the 1st respondent vide proceedings dated 22.09.2025 directed the 2nd respondent to forward a report to include the petitioner's name in the panel of Deputy Tahsildars drawn for the year 2011 and sought the entire file. Thereafter, the petitioner sent a representation dated 21.02.2026 seeking indulgence of the respondents to pass orders. Since there is no response the petitioner is before this Court.
5. Considering the facts and circumstances of the case and the fact that the petitioner's representation dated 21.02.2026 has not been considered to date, a direction is issued to respondents to consider the petitioner's representation in the light of the proceedings of the 1st respondent dated 22.09.2025 and pass orders on merits and in accordance with law, within a period of 8 we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this order.
6. With the above direction, this writ petition is disposed of. No costs.
